> > On Thu, 9 Mar 2006, Kelson wrote:
> >
> > > We put the following in our qpopper.config:
> > > set spool-options = true
> >
> > Which seems to be the same as putting -U in the inetd.conf file...
> >
> > > Then we set up .username.qpopper-options files in our spool directory
> > > containing:
> > > set server-mode = true
> > And can I add
> > set fast-update = true
> > on a per user basis?
>
> Yes, you can set fast-update on a per-user basis.
I have done exactly that. I'm not seeing much improvement, but I may
have discovered a bug in the PDF file. In the tables (pages 26, 36)
this file is referred to as "user.qpopper-options" and
"username.qpopper-options" but in the text pages 27, 42 it is
referred to as ".user.qpopper.options". Possibly the use of
"userNAME" [my emphasis] is an error, but is the ".user" form
correct or the "user (with no leading .)" form correct? A search of
the PDF for qpopper-options will turn up what I mean.
